After a year defined by consistency and growth, rising UK R&B artist Ama Louise closes out 2025 in style with the release of her long-awaited debut EP, 'Long Story Short' - an eight-track statement piece that cements her as one of the most exciting new voices in British R&B.


Ama Louise - Long Story Short

It’s been a breakout year for Ama. Kicking things off with 'Focus', she quickly found her stride, following up with fan favourites 'Hindsight' and “' Don’t Mind'. Each release peeled back a new layer of her artistry - her soulful tone, honest lyricism, and effortless ability to glide across contemporary R&B production - all culminating in this stunning debut project.


Across 'Long Story Short', Ama showcases her full range. The EP flows between introspective moments and smooth, melody-rich soundscapes, giving listeners a glimpse into the emotional depth that underpins her songwriting. Her voice takes centre stage throughout, carrying stories of love, self-assurance, and growth with poise and authenticity.



What sets this release apart is its cohesion. Every track feels intentionally placed, building a world that’s distinctly Ama’s - confident, warm, and rooted in soulful honesty. With an already impressive catalogue and undeniable momentum behind her, 'Long Story Short' feels like a pivotal moment. It’s the sound of an artist ready to take the leap - setting the tone for what promises to be a career-defining 2026.
